Reports To: Chief of Institutional Advancement
Job Summary
The Director of Admissions is appointed by and reports directly to the Chief of Institutional Advancement and serves as the senior leader responsible for all aspects of enrollment management at Saint Louis School, an all-boys Catholic Marianist school serving grades K–12.
The Director of Admissions provides strategic vision and operational leadership for the admissions and re-enrollment programs, ensuring sustainable enrollment, mission alignment, and positive experience for prospective and current families. This role oversees recruitment, admissions operations, marketing collaboration, data analysis, budgeting, and long-range enrollment planning. The Director serves as a key ambassador for Saint Louis School within the local, national, and international community.
Duties and Responsibilities
Admissions & Enrollment Leadership
- Provide leadership and oversight for the admissions program for all new students entering grades K–12.
- Develop, implement, and continuously assess enrollment strategies to maintain capacity enrollment of qualified students.
- Work collaboratively with school leadership to support retention.
- Conduct ongoing evaluation and redesign of admissions and marketing practices to respond to enrollment trends and institutional priorities.
Recruitment & Family Engagement
- Represent Saint Louis School to prospective students and families through campus tours, interviews, open houses, school fairs, and community events.
- Ensure systematic, efficient, and mission-centered handling of all admissions processes, including:
- Application management and communication
- Candidate and parent interviews
- Admissions testing coordination.
- Collection and evaluation of student credentials
- Communication of admissions decisions
- Coordinate and lead bi-annual Open Houses for lower, middle, and high school divisions.
Feeder School & Community Relations
- Coordinate visits to and partnerships with Catholic grade schools, as well as private and public grade and intermediate schools.
- Maintain strong working relationships with counselors, teachers, administrators, and parish communities at feeder schools.
- Cultivate opportunities for feeder school faculty, administrators, parents, former parents, and alumni to support recruitment efforts.
Marketing, Communications & Budget Management
- Oversee the admissions office, including staff supervision and daily operations.
- Develop and manage the admissions budget in alignment with institutional goals.
- Create and implement a comprehensive admissions marketing plan, including print and electronic communications, publications, mailings, and digital outreach.
- Coordinate all admissions marketing and communications efforts with the Marketing and Development Team to ensure consistent branding and messaging.
Financial Aid & Scholarships
- Coordinate the communication of scholarships and financial aid information for all incoming students.
- Collaborate closely with the Development and Business Offices in support of the school’s scholarship and financial aid program needs for new students.
- Communicate clearly and compassionately with families regarding tuition, financial aid policies, timelines, and procedures.
Data, Reporting & Planning
- Maintain accurate and relevant statistics on all aspects of admissions and re-enrollment, including inquiries, applications, yield, financial aid, and retention.
- Use data analysis to inform enrollment forecasting, strategic planning, and reporting to school leadership.
- Design and implement long-range enrollment plans aligned with the school’s mission and strategic priorities.
International Student Programs & Compliance
- Coordinate and implement immigration policies for all international applicants and enrolled students.
- Monitor and administer the SEVIS program, ensuring compliance with all federal regulations governing student visa programs.
- Implement and monitor rules and regulations applicable to international students throughout their enrollment.
